Junk Removal Tips for Sebring, FL

How much does junk removal cost?

  • Minimum charge: $75-$150
  • Household junk: $300-$700
  • Construction, concrete, brick debris: $300-$1,000
  • Yard waste: $200-$800

Junk removal costs are generally steeper in cities with a higher cost of living, such as New York City or Los Angeles, and lower in areas with a low cost of living. The distance the dumpster or junk removal company has to travel to/from your property, as well as to the landfill or recycling center, may also influence pricing.

How do junk removal costs compare to the cost of renting a dumpster?

The pricing in both cases can vary significantly based on your location, the type/amount of material to be loaded, etc. In most cases, dumpster rental prices fall between $300 and $600 for a seven-day rental.

The pricing structure for most junk removal services is based on the type of junk you’re removing and how much of it.

If you need to remove only a few large items, like furniture or appliances, hiring a junk removal service is the more cost-effective option. Renting a dumpster is more economical choice for bigger jobs where you’ll be throwing out at least 7-cubic-yards of material or more.
